V-Mart, Marico, Devyani among 80+ firms reporting Q1FY25 earnings today
A dense earnings day for Indian consumer and retail names: V-Mart Retail, Marico, Devyani International, Hawkins and Monte Carlo Fashions report Q1FY25 results, with Godrej Consumer due this week. Early prints show Deepak Nitrite profit up 35.1% to Rs 202.53 crore on revenue up 22.5%.

What to watch
- Marico/Godrej rural vs urban volume growth divergence in management commentary
- Devyani SSSG and store-addition guidance vs QSR peers
- Gross margin trajectory guidance amid commodity moves
- V-Mart footfall/ticket-size trends signaling mass-market recovery
- Godrej Consumer print later this week as cluster confirmation
- Screen for volume-vs-value growth split across FMCG prints to separate demand recovery from price-led optics
- Watch QSR peer read-through (Devyani to Jubilant, Sapphire, Westlife) on same-store sales and unit economics
- Position value-retail (V-Mart, Vishal) as rural-recovery proxies if Marico rural commentary is constructive
- Track input-cost commentary (palm oil, crude derivatives via Deepak Nitrite) for margin sustainability into H2
